Sažetak: The material properties (TCE, dielectric number, etc.) ofdifferent LTCC (L.ow [empercuure f;.o-fired f;.eramics) - tape materials were characterized separately and compared to the behavior of combinations ofthese tapes that were laminated and co-fired. The effects ofdifferent values ofthermal expansion and change in dielectric number ofthe combined material stacks have been investigated by finite element analyses and verified using a wireless readout resonant temperature sensor as a demonstration device.
